Celebrating Canadian Identity: Citizenship Week Concludes with Virtual Ceremony

May 27, 2022—Ottawa, Ontario — Citizenship Week serves as a momentous occasion for Canadians domestically and globally to celebrate the nation's rich history, diverse culture, and significant achievements.

In a fitting conclusion to this year's Citizenship Week, the Honourable Sean Fraser, Minister of Immigration, Refugees and Citizenship, participated in a virtual citizenship ceremony. This event, organized in collaboration with the Institute for Canadian Citizenship, marked the official welcoming of 25 new Canadians, each taking their Oath of Citizenship in a heartfelt ceremony.

Celebrating Canadian Citizenship

During the event, Minister Fraser highlighted the profound importance of Canadian citizenship. He emphasized the rights and freedoms it guarantees, alongside the responsibilities it entails. The Minister also addressed the ongoing efforts to assist individuals and families aspiring to join the Canadian citizenry, assuring them that the Immigration, Refugees and Citizenship Canada (IRCC) is committed to expediting their journey to citizenship.

Meeting and Exceeding Goals

The IRCC's diligent efforts have borne fruit, as Canada surpassed its citizenship targets for the 2021-2022 period, welcoming over 217,000 new citizens. This achievement sets a promising precedent for the 2022-2023 fiscal year, with plans to welcome even more.

In pursuit of these goals, the IRCC has been modernizing its approach to citizenship services. Notably, on November 26, 2020, Canada became one of the pioneering nations to offer online citizenship testing. This innovation, coupled with the swift adaptation to COVID-19 through virtual ceremonies initiated in April 2020, has significantly enhanced the accessibility of citizenship proceedings. As a result, more individuals can now take citizenship tests and participate in ceremonies than was previously possible before the pandemic.

A Milestone in the Immigration Journey

Achieving Canadian citizenship represents a significant milestone in any newcomer's journey. The IRCC remains steadfast in its commitment to facilitating this process, ensuring that as many individuals as possible can attain this cherished status. Backed by additional funding from the 2021 Economic and Fiscal Update, efforts to reduce the application backlog accumulated during the pandemic are ongoing.
